Retired Colonel Ken Grundborg was unable to attend two graduation ceremonies at Georgia Tech due to active military service. Today, he walked across the stage at 88-years old.
Grundborg earned his bachelor’s degree in 1960 and his master’s in 1966 — both in civil engineering. He missed his ceremony when the @usarmy called him to serve his country. He spent 20 years with the Army Corps of Engineers, also serving in the 82nd Airborne Division, the Rangers, and the Pathfinders.
